Key Features of Art Deco-Inspired Gold Jewelry
Art Deco-inspired gold jewelry is characterized by clean lines, geometric shapes, and luxurious materials, all of which contribute to its timeless retro appeal. This style, popular in the 1920s and 30s, continues to captivate modern audiences due to its sophisticated elegance. Birmingham jewellery designers often incorporate intricate details such as faceted stones, bold graining, and symmetrical patterns into their Art Deco-inspired pieces. The use of high-karat gold ensures a warm, lustrous finish that enhances the overall allure of these vintage-style accessories.
Key features include sleek profiles, precise cuts, and a focus on balance and proportion. This aesthetic is achieved through intricate craftsmanship, often involving techniques like granulation, filigree work, and milgrain borders. Birmingham jewellery pieces in this genre are not just visually stunning but also tell a story of yesteryear’s glamour, making them sought-after by collectors and fashion enthusiasts alike.
Styling Tips for a Retro-Modern Look
When styling Art Deco-inspired gold jewelry, a retro-modern look can be achieved by blending vintage aesthetics with modern silhouettes. Pair bold, geometric pieces like statement necklaces or ear cuffs with contemporary clothing for a unique contrast. For instance, a Birmingham jewellery shop might suggest layering a long, intricate necklace over a minimalist shirt and high-waisted pants to create a stylish fusion of old and new.
Accessories play a vital role too; opt for simple, sleek watches and minimalists rings to balance the boldness of Art Deco pieces. The key is to embrace the contrast between vintage glamour and modern simplicity, allowing your jewellery to tell a story while still looking contemporary. This approach ensures that Birmingham jewellery lovers can enjoy the retro appeal of Art Deco without sacrificing their modern sense of style.
